Tim Holtz 12 days of Christmas tags Day 8


Oh, didn't like this one at all. I had to draw and make my own mask, and in paper is was very difficult to ink it up properly. The whole thing ended up with a halo round it. Good technique, but only with the right stuff. I used a Crafty Individuals flourish stamp, and cut out some houses on card. Inked them up, and painted some puff paint on the top for snow. I didn't like the clock or photo corners so left them out, and put on a wooden Christmas tree instead. Not my favourite tag.
